Weddings have changed dramatically in the past few years. Couples want more from a wedding these days expecting a lot of innovation, they don’t want the traditional, normal photography anymore. They often ask for documentary or candid wedding photography packages because it captures the emotions of not only the couple but also the guests enjoying themselves without lining them up in front of the camera.
What is Candid Photography? Any photo captured through a professional camera without disturbing the subject in motion is called as candid photography. In weddings, the subject or subjects aren’t asked to pose and it’s usually taken without them noticing you. The candid nature of a photograph is unrelated to the subject’s knowledge about or consent to the fact that photographs are being taken and unrelated to the subject’s permission for further usage and distribution.
